There's a huge Street Fighter collection coming up from Capcom! It's called Street Fighter 25th Anniversary Collector's Set and it's really similar to the Resident Evil 15th Anniversary Collection you might remember from a while back. Now, while the RE collection never made it outside of Japan I really, really, REALLY hope that this one gets an international release because it would be the best way to get all of the SF games. Well, all but the first.

The set will be priced at $149.99 which I think is a rather reasonable price for it and will be released on September 18th.

The set will include
  • Super Street Fighter 2 Turbo HD Remix
  • Street Fighter 3: 3rd Strike Online Edition
  • Super Street Fighter 4 Arcade Edition (with all costume DLC)
  • Street Fighter X Tekken (including all character and Swap Costume DLC)
  • Two-disc Blu-Ray video set including a documentary on the series' history, the Street Fighter 4 and Super Street Fighter 4 Anime movies, episodes of the Street Fighter animated series, and Street Fighter 2: The Animated Movie
  • 8" light-up Ryu statue
  • 11 discs of soundtrack music
  • 64 page hardback art book
  • Ryu's belt replica
  • Certificate of authenticity
